Castor oil is a remarkable natural remedy that has been utilized for centuries to enhance skin health. This thick, honey-hued oil is packed with vitamins and minerals, which condition the sensitive skin on your face. Frequent application of castor oil can bring about a range of benefits, including reduced inflammation.

It's also known for its ability to fight bacteria and fungus, making it perfect for tackling acne and other skin issues.

Moreover, castor oil can efficiently mitigate skin by locking in moisture. This helps to maintain a glowing complexion and makes your skin feel smooth.

Finally, castor oil can also stimulate new cell growth, contributing to a more youthful appearance.

Reveal Your Skin's Potential with Castor Oil: A Step-by-Step Guide

Castor oil, a secret of nature, has been used for centuries to promote skin health. Its rich features can help soothe various get more info skin concerns. Whether you're looking to reduce inflammation, hydrate dry complexion, or fight acne, castor oil can be a valuable asset to your skincare routine. Here's a step-by-step protocol to effectively apply castor oil to your skin:

  • Start by cleansing your face with a gentle soap.
  • Pat your skin thoroughly with a clean towel.
  • Slightly heat a small portion of castor oil in your palms.
  • Massage the warm castor oil evenly onto your skin using gentle strokes.
  • Concentrate on areas of concern.
  • Permit the castor oil to soak in for at least 15 minutes.
  • Remove any excess castor oil with lukewarm fluid.
  • Hydrate your skin as usual.

At-Home Castor Oil Facial: Recipe for Radiant Complexion

Treat your skin to a luxurious experience with this simple quick DIY castor oil facial. Castor oil is known for its amazing benefits for the skin, like reducing inflammation, promoting collagen, and moisturizing even the delicate complexions. This natural blend will leave your face feeling vibrant.

Here's what you'll need:

* 1 tablespoon cold-pressed castor oil

* A few of your favorite carrier oil, such as coconut or jojoba oil

* Depending on your preference a few drops of essential oil for aroma, such as lavender or rose

To prepare this mask:

1. Combine the castor oil and carrier oil in a small bowl.

2. Add your chosen essential oil, if desired.

3. Carefully massage the mixture onto your clean face in upward massaging motions for about 2-3 minutes. Focus on areas that need extra attention, such as wrinkles or dark spots.

4. Leave the mask to work on your skin for 15-20 minutes.

5. Wash the mask with warm water and a gentle cleanser. Pat your face dry with a soft towel.

Your face will feel amazing. Embrace your radiant glow!

Is Castor Oil Appropriate for Your Facial Routine?

Castor oil has gained popularity in the beauty world, with many touting its benefits for skin and hair. But is it truly the ultimate solution for your face? Castor oil is a thick, sticky oil extracted from the seeds of the castor plant. It's rich in ricinoleic acid, a fatty acid that exhibits anti-inflammatory and antibacterial traits. Some people find that applying castor oil to their skin can alleviate acne, enhance collagen production, and even relieve rashes.

However, it's important to evaluate castor oil with awareness. Its thick consistency can be challenging to penetrate into the skin, potentially resulting clogged pores.

Furthermore, some people may experience allergic reactions to castor oil.

If you're considering adding castor oil to your facial routine, it's best to start with a limited test on a discreet area of skin first.

Listen to how your skin responds, and consult with a dermatologist if you have any worries.

  • Keep in mind that everyone's skin is different, so what works for one person may not work for another.

Tricks and Strategies for Applying Castor Oil Safely to Face

Before you slather castor oil all over your face, remember that a little goes a long way! Begin with a small quantity and gradually increase it as you grow comfortable. Constantly conduct a trial run first to assess for any negative reactions. If your skin handles it well, you can put castor oil to your face before bed as a moisturizer. Mix it with a carrier oil like jojoba or coconut oil for a softer result. Avoid the eye area as castor oil can be harmful there. Wash your face thoroughly after putting on castor oil to avoid acne.

  • Keep in mind that everyone's skin is different, so what works for one person may not work for another.
  • Pay attention your skin and modify your routine as needed.
  • Talk to a dermatologist if you have any issues about using castor oil on your face.

Say Goodbye to Blemishes: Using Castor Oil for Acne Scars eliminate

Castor oil has become a popular remedy for acne scars due to its amazing healing characteristics. This natural oil is rich in ricinoleic acid, which possesses anti-inflammatory and antibacterial attributes that can help diminish the appearance of scars. Applying castor oil topically can promote skin healing, leading to a smoother and more even complexion.

To use castor oil for acne scars, simply apply a few drops onto the affected area twice a day. You can also mix it with other natural ingredients like tea tree oil or aloe vera for enhanced results. Consistency is key when using castor oil, so keep up the application for several weeks to see significant improvements.
